pub struct StdoutHandler { /* private fields */ }Expand description
Simple logging handler that prints to stdout.
Implementations§
Source§impl StdoutHandler
impl StdoutHandler
Sourcepub fn new() -> StdoutHandler
pub fn new() -> StdoutHandler
Create a new stdout handler.
Sourcepub fn min_severity(self, severity: SecurityEventSeverity) -> StdoutHandler
pub fn min_severity(self, severity: SecurityEventSeverity) -> StdoutHandler
Set minimum severity to log.
Trait Implementations§
Source§impl Default for StdoutHandler
impl Default for StdoutHandler
Source§fn default() -> StdoutHandler
fn default() -> StdoutHandler
Returns the “default value” for a type. Read more
Source§impl SecurityEventHandler for StdoutHandler
impl SecurityEventHandler for StdoutHandler
Source§fn handle(&self, event: &SecurityEvent)
fn handle(&self, event: &SecurityEvent)
Handle a security event.
Auto Trait Implementations§
impl Freeze for StdoutHandler
impl RefUnwindSafe for StdoutHandler
impl Send for StdoutHandler
impl Sync for StdoutHandler
impl Unpin for StdoutHandler
impl UnwindSafe for StdoutHandler
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more